Each year in the UK, people are killed, injured and suffer work-related illnesses while carrying out their jobs.

 

So Health & Safety is a significant concern. The government, employers and workers all have an essential role to play in reducing deaths and accidents and preventing ill-health at work.

This online Level 1 Health and Safety in a Construction Environment E-Learning course is aimed at people starting out in the construction industry and can be used as part of their induction process or as preparation for the online accredited exam. Whilst this course, Level 1 Health & Safety in a Construction environment, provides you with a qualification in its own right, it can also form part of your CSCS green card application.

 

The Level 1 Health and Safety in a Construction Environment online course starts by introducing the legal aspects of health and safety before covering the basics of risk assessment and safe working practices. The Level 1 Health and Safety in a Construction Environment E-Learning course then goes into detail to cover the most common hazards encountered in construction environments, from Working at Height and Respiratory Hazards to electrical and chemical hazards

What will I learn in this course?

Course Modules:

Introduction

Hazards, Risks, Assessments and Controls

Slips, Trips, Falls and Working at Height

Manual handling

Plant, Machinery and Noise

Respiratory Risks

Fire, Electricity and Gas Safety

Chemicals and Other Onsite Hazards

Vehicles, PPE and General Safety

Your Pathway to Your CSCS Card
